35% BANDWIDTH Q-TO-W-BAND FREQUENCY DOUBLER. Academic Article uri icon

abstract

  • A very broadband Q- to W-band MIC frequency doubler with a 28 GHz bandwidth, employing a unique planar balanced circuit configuration, has been developed using two beam-lead Schottky barrier diodes as varistors. The doubler exhibits output power of 7 plus or minus 1 dNm and covnersion loss of 13 plus or minus 1 dB over the 66 to 94 GHz output frequency range.
